在当今互联网时代,信息量的爆炸式增长使得数据的处理和分析变得尤为重要。在Java Web开发中,JSP(JavaServer Pages)作为最常用的技术之一,经常需要实现数据的分页显示。本文将详细介绍JSP查询数据分页显示的实例,从入门到实践,帮助你轻松掌握这一技术。

1. 前言

在开发过程中,我们经常会遇到需要展示大量数据的情况。如果一次性将所有数据加载到页面上,不仅会严重影响用户体验,还会增加服务器的压力。因此,分页显示应运而生。本文将详细介绍如何使用JSP实现数据分页显示。

jsp查询数据分页显示实例_jsp查询数据分页显示实例内容  第1张

2. 环境搭建

在开始编写代码之前,我们需要搭建一个JSP开发环境。以下是一个简单的环境搭建步骤:

软件版本下载链接
JDK1.8+https://www.oracle.com/java/technologies/javase-downloads.html
Tomcat9.0+https://tomcat.apache.org/download-90.cgi
Eclipse4.13+https://www.eclipse.org/downloads/

3. 数据库准备

为了方便演示,本文使用MySQL数据库作为数据源。以下是创建一个简单数据库的SQL语句:

```sql

CREATE DATABASE jsp_demo;

USE jsp_demo;

CREATE TABLE users (

id INT AUTO_INCREMENT PRIMARY KEY,

username VARCHAR(50) NOT NULL,

password VARCHAR(50) NOT NULL,

email VARCHAR(100)

);

```

插入一些测试数据:

```sql

INSERT INTO users (username, password, email) VALUES ('admin', 'admin123', 'admin@example.com');

INSERT INTO users (username, password, email) VALUES ('user1', 'user123', 'user1@example.com');

INSERT INTO users (username, password, email) VALUES ('user2', 'user123', 'user2@example.com');

```

4. JSP代码实现

下面是JSP代码实现分页显示的步骤:

4.1 数据库连接

我们需要建立一个数据库连接。以下是连接MySQL数据库的Java代码:

```java

public class DBUtil {

private static final String URL = "